Mount Yasur, on the island of Tanna, is one of the world's most accessible and reliably active volcanoes, offering a genuinely thrilling and rare experience: the chance to stand on the rim of an erupting crater. A short walk from where vehicles stop leads right to the edge, where visitors can gaze down into the roaring vent as it spews glowing molten rock, ash and gas in frequent, thunderous explosions. By day it is dramatic; after dark, the spectacle becomes mesmerising, with fountains of red-hot lava blazing against the night sky, an unforgettable and primal encounter with the raw power of the earth.

When to go
April to October, the drier, cooler season, for the best weather; the volcano is most spectacular at dusk and after dark, when the glowing lava shows most dramatically, so a late-afternoon or evening visit is ideal. Access depends on the volcano's activity level, which is monitored, and the crater can close when eruptions intensify.
Honest expectations
This is a genuinely active volcano, so access depends on the current activity level and can be restricted or closed for safety when eruptions intensify, and standing near an erupting crater carries inherent risk; it is reached by a flight to Tanna and a rough drive, so it takes effort and expense. When conditions allow, though, gazing into an erupting crater at spewing, glowing lava, especially after dark, is one of the most extraordinary and primal experiences on earth.
